Core Mechanisms: How It Works

When you connect to a WiFi network on Android, your device doesn’t just remember the SSID—it stores the **pre-shared key (PSK)**, which is the password itself, in an encrypted format within the system’s **WiFi configuration files**. These files are typically located in `/data/misc/wifi/` but are inaccessible without root access. Instead, Android provides a front-end way to retrieve the password through the **WiFi settings menu**, provided you’re the network owner or have the necessary permissions.

The process hinges on two key components: 1. **Saved Networks List**: Your phone maintains a database of all WiFi networks it’s ever connected to, including passwords for those marked as "saved." This list is accessible via the **WiFi settings** > **Saved networks** (or similar, depending on the device). 2. **Network Details Page**: Tapping a saved network opens a details page where the password is displayed—*if* the network is currently connected or if the device has the proper permissions. On newer Android versions, this step may require additional confirmation or biometric authentication.

Q: How do I use ADB to find my WiFi password on Android?

ADB (Android Debug Bridge) is a powerful tool for advanced users. Here’s how to retrieve a WiFi password via command line:

  1. Enable **Developer Options** by tapping **Build Number** 7 times in **Settings > About phone**.
  2. Go to **Developer Options** and enable **USB Debugging**.
  3. Connect your phone to a PC via USB and open **Command Prompt** (Windows) or **Terminal** (Mac/Linux).
  4. Run the following commands:
    adb devices
    adb shell
    su
    cat /data/misc/wifi/WifiConfigStore.xml
  5. Look for the `` section with your SSID—passwords are stored as `` values (often encrypted; use `strings` command to decode).
*Note: ADB requires root access on locked-down devices. Proceed with caution.*

Q: Can I export my WiFi passwords to another device?

Android doesn’t natively support exporting WiFi passwords, but you can: 1. **Manually re-enter** passwords on the new device (tedious but secure). 2. **Use a password manager** (e.g., LastPass, Bitwarden) that syncs WiFi credentials across devices. 3. **Transfer the `WifiConfigStore.xml` file** via ADB (advanced; requires root). 4. **Set up WiFi sharing** via QR codes (Android 10+) or NFC (if both devices support it). *Note: Sharing passwords via unsecured methods (e.g., text/SMS) is risky.*
